explorer is about the only true "bolt in" seat for the ext cabs (98+). however, mustang, bronco II seats and others can be made to fit.

as for seat covers, any upholstery shop can make them. i make them all the time. i wouldn't go to the dealership. they can get them (as long as they aren't discontinued), however, you will pay twice as much for the covers as most places will charge to recover.

yes. we have books that we call detroit books. all they are is samples of all the factory materials. we get a new one each year. have them all the way back to the 70s. now, some factory materials get discontinued shortly after production and may not be available. but for an 04, they should be available.
